什麼是動態網站•│₪◕?建站時很多朋友會問這個問題₪▩╃,動態網站並不是指具有動畫功能的網站₪▩╃,而是指網站內容可根據不同情況動態變更的網站₪▩╃,一般情況下動態網站透過資料庫進行架構↟••。 下面講一下動態網站與靜態網站區別₪▩╃,或許你會更明白一些↟••。
靜態網站☁☁:
1☁✘╃☁、每個靜態網頁都有一個固定的網址₪▩╃,檔名均以htm☁✘╃☁、html☁✘╃☁、shtml等為字尾;
2☁✘╃☁、靜態網頁一經發布到伺服器上₪▩╃,無論是否被訪問₪▩╃,都是一個獨立存在的檔案;
3☁✘╃☁、靜態網頁的內容相對穩定₪▩╃,不含特殊程式碼₪▩╃,因此容易被搜尋引擎檢索;html更加適合SEO搜尋引擎最佳化↟••。
4☁✘╃☁、靜態網站沒有資料庫的支援₪▩╃,在網站製作和維護方面工作量較大;
5☁✘╃☁、由於不需透過資料庫工作₪▩╃,所以靜態網頁的訪問速度比較快;
現在流行的cms都支援靜態化網頁₪▩╃,這有利於被搜尋引擎收錄和提高訪問速度₪▩╃,但需要佔用較大的伺服器空間₪▩╃,程式在生成html的時候非常消耗伺服器資源₪▩╃,建議在伺服器空閒的時候進行此類操作↟••。

動態網站☁☁:
1☁✘╃☁、動態網站可以實現互動功能₪▩╃,如使用者註冊☁✘╃☁、資訊釋出☁✘╃☁、產品展示☁✘╃☁、訂單管理等等;
2☁✘╃☁、動態網頁並不是獨立存在於伺服器的網頁檔案₪▩╃,而是瀏覽器發出請求時才反饋網頁;
3☁✘╃☁、動態網頁中包含有伺服器端指令碼₪▩╃,所以頁面檔名常以asp☁✘╃☁、jsp☁✘╃☁、php等為字尾↟••。但也可以使用URL靜態化技術₪▩╃,使網頁字尾顯示為HTML↟••。所以不能以頁面檔案的字尾作為判斷網站的動態和靜態的唯一標準↟••。
4☁✘╃☁、動態網頁由於需要資料庫處理₪▩╃,所以動態網站的訪問速度大大減慢;
5☁✘╃☁、動態網頁由於存在特殊程式碼₪▩╃,所以相比較靜態網頁₪▩╃,其對搜尋引擎的友好程度相對要弱一些↟••。
但隨著計算機效能的提升以及網路頻寬的提升₪▩╃,最後兩條已經基本得到解決↟••。
動態網站開發不同於其他的應用程式開發₪▩╃,它需要有多種開發技術結合在一起使用↟••。每種技術的功能各自獨立而又要相互配合才能完成一個動態網站的建立↟••。至於動態網站需要用到什麼程式語言來開發₪▩╃,可以閱讀《動態網站需要用什麼語言程式碼寫》
以上就是關於【什麼是動態網站•│₪◕?建站時很多朋友會問這個問題】的文章內容₪▩╃,如果您還想了解更多關於網站建設與網路推廣的相關文章₪▩╃,請繼續檢視【網站製作】欄目的其它文章
來源www.tjzymf.com廣州明行威₪▩╃,致力於中小企業網路營銷推廣☁✘╃☁、整體外包運營(網站建設☁✘╃☁、SEM☁✘╃☁、SEO等)☁✘╃☁、企業SEO內訓☁✘╃☁、資訊流廣告運營
歡迎交流 加微信13430336474 廣州張楷

上一篇☁☁:動態網站需要用什麼語言程式碼寫
下一篇☁☁:新增什麼程式碼讓百度識別PC站和手機站